Axente Sever (until 1931 Frâua; German: Frauendorf; Hungarian: Asszonyfalva) is a commune located in Sibiu County, Transylvania, Romania, named after Ioan Axente Sever.

The commune is composed of three villages: Agârbiciu (Arbegen; Szászegerbegy), Axente Sever and Șoala (Schaal; Sálya). In each of these three villages there are Saxon fortified churches erected in the 14th century and fortified till the 16th century.

The route of the Via Transilvanica long-distance trail passes through the villages of Axente Sever and Agârbiciu.[2]
